The chapter scrutinizes the complex web of conflicting interests surrounding Larry Summers, exposing his significant influence in shaping economic discourse despite questionable predictions and ethical concerns. It delves into the lack of transparency in media portrayal of public figures like former government officials, highlighting the impact of undisclosed corporate affiliations on perceptions of expertise. The discussion also explores the revolving door politics in Washington D.C., emphasizing the need for transparency and accountability to address conflicts of interest in consultancy and government-private sector transitions.
